Decorated Vase


JE 37341 Cairo Antiquities Museum Material: Quartzite
Size: Height: 74 cm
Location: Karnak, Temple of Amun-Re, Courtyard of the Cachette
Excavation: G. Legrain's Excavations of 1904
Period: Early 26th Dynasty (Second Half of 7th Century BC) Petamenhotep was actually a High Priest but here he is depicted in the traditional pose of a scribe, with some exceptions. In his right hand he would once have held a stylus while his left supported a papyrus scroll.
